Tatterdemalion (1920) by John Galsworthy is a story collection divided in two parts, of wartime and peacetime, and examining all strata of society. British author John Galsworthy is best known for his monumental The Forsyte Saga, and his intense, complex psychological portraits represent the transition from the Victorian to the Edwardian period.
